Output 54ed5fe451a8cf95805d3518193926c1f6c8f95d8345d19d8a10e51c64c75b56:3

value
133581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ed87a26196f0ebf079ade96b0a7a5b8070273fa0 OP_EQUAL
address
3PLxZ3WStuYufCzcVz7KHhJypm6tbGGgxY
transaction
54ed5fe451a8cf95805d3518193926c1f6c8f95d8345d19d8a10e51c64c75b56
spent
true